Synthesis, Structure, and Photochromic Properties of Dithia‐(dithienylethena)phane Derivatives

Abstract Dithia‐(dithienylethena)phane derivatives, composed of dithienylethene moieties and benzene bridges, were synthesized by a coupling reaction of the corresponding bis(chloromethyl)benzene with bis(mercaptomethyl)dithienylethene under high‐dilution conditions. The products exhibit photochromic properties upon irradiation with ultraviolet and visible light. The photocyclization and cycloreversion quantum yields were determined, and a relationship between the photocyclization quantum yield and distance between the reactive carbon atoms of the phane derivatives established. The ortho isomer has a high efficiency in photocyclization due to its fixation in the photo‐active anti conformation and short distance between the two reactive carbon atoms. The thermal stability of these photochromic compounds has been studied and the ortho isomer found to show thermal irreversibility. (© Wiley‐VCH Verlag GmbH & Co. KGaA, 69451 Weinheim, Germany, 2005)
